Hi all

I just got me a D-Link D660CT pcmcia ethernet card, because I got tired of slow file copying over serial connection.

However, I have a problem. When I copy an mp3 file from my desktop computer (w2k) to iPAQ (pocket pc 2000), the file seems to get errors. When I listen to it on Windows Media Player 7.1, it jumps to the next song after a minute or so. Surprisingly, Media Player 7.0 plays the song to the end, but I can here sound errors in the song. What is even more surprising, is that when I copy the songs using MusicMatch Jukebox's new pocket pc plug-in, there are no errors. I would be happy with this, but Jukebox changes the file names leaving just the song title in the file name - which isnt't very nice when I am trying to manage all the songs in my 1 GB microdrive. Anybody having same kind of problems? Any ideas what I could do about this?

I'm answering to myself. I tried everything I could think of: downloaded the latest build of Activesync and even updated to Pocket PC 2002 (I finally got the cd from Modusmedia, Netherlands, after waiting for it for 3 months - but that is another long story). No help at all.

Then I happened to plug in the pcmcia cards I have in different slots: microdrive to slot 2 and ethernet card to slot 1. Activesync still made errors when copying files. However, using netrunner and copying files using Ipaq's file explorer, I got it working! I mean there are still little errors, but now the mp3:s won't skip and maybe 1 song of 15 has a little error. Previously every single mp3 file had errors that made Media player to skip to next file. Pocket divx played them, but it sounded horrible. Problem wasn't only in the mp3 files, I couldn't get the Service Pack 1 to install copying the file using Activesync.

Sweet that it works, but the problem is strange anyhow. I wonder if anybody has experienced same kind of problems...

Does it do this just for mp3 files or for all files? I had a similar problem with my iPaq and a wireless network card, in that it wouldn't copy any files over like 1.3MB. Compaq finally replaced my PCMCIA sleve and that fixed the problem.
